The 2025 Volkswagen Golf GTI is available in three distinct trim levels: S, SE, and Autobahn, each powered by a 2.0-liter TSI engine generating 241 horsepower and 273 lb-ft of torque, all channeled to the front wheels via a seven-speed dual-clutch transmission. The S model, as the entry-level option, comes generously equipped with features like automatic and adaptive headlights, a 12.9-inch infotainment display, IQ.Drive safety systems, and heated seats, alongside a standard limited-slip differential. Upgrading to the SE adds a sunroof, a premium Harman/Kardon sound system, and unique 18-inch alloy wheels, along with Clubsport seats. The top-tier Autobahn trim boasts 19-inch alloy wheels, adaptive suspension, a head-up display, and ventilated front seats, catering to enhanced comfort and driving dynamics. While European versions of the Golf GTI enjoy a slightly higher power output of 261 horsepower, the North American models continue to deliver a thrilling and engaging driving experience, despite the discontinuation of the manual transmission.

The 2026 Santa Fe Hybrid introduces a new base SE trim and subtle enhancements to its existing versions. Under the hood, every model features a robust turbocharged 1.6-liter four-cylinder hybrid system, delivering a combined output of 231 horsepower, seamlessly paired with a six-speed automatic transmission. Front-wheel drive is standard, with all-wheel drive available as an optional upgrade. Key features across the range include a 12.3-inch infotainment system with wireless Apple CarPlay and Android Auto compatibility, along with available captain’s chairs, dual wireless chargers, and a premium audio experience. Advanced safety technologies such as automated emergency braking, lane assist, and blind-spot monitoring are also integrated to enhance driver confidence and passenger safety.

The interior of the Santa Fe Hybrid is meticulously designed, offering a refined cabin that comfortably accommodates up to seven passengers. Thoughtful storage solutions and a flexible cargo area, expanding to 80 cubic feet with the seats folded, underscore its practicality. The quality of interior materials progressively improves with higher trim levels, culminating in the Calligraphy's exquisite Pecan Brown Nappa leather finish, which adds a touch of opulent elegance.

The Dominance of GM's Large SUVs in the Middle East Market

This article explores the burgeoning success of General Motors' large sport utility vehicles (SUVs) within the Middle Eastern market, highlighting the key factors contributing to their growing popularity and impressive sales figures.

Unveiling the Surge: GM's Full-Size SUVs Conquer the Middle East

GM's Escalating Triumph in the Middle Eastern Automotive Landscape

General Motors is witnessing remarkable achievements in the Middle East, primarily fueled by the exceptional performance of its large SUV segment. This region stands out as the only territory outside of the United States where GM offers its complete range of full-size SUVs. During the third quarter of 2025, sales soared by an impressive 28% compared to the previous year. This growth is consistent across all three of GM's brands in the region, with the Chevrolet Tahoe and Suburban, GMC Yukon, and Cadillac Escalade all reporting substantial increases. The leading markets driving this surge include Saudi Arabia, the United Arab Emirates, and Kuwait.

First Quarter Momentum: A Snapshot of Rapid Expansion

The upward trend in sales was even more pronounced earlier in the year. In the first quarter of 2025, GM Middle East announced an overall sales increase of 26%, with full-size SUV sales experiencing a dramatic 55% year-over-year surge. Specifically, the Tahoe and Suburban models saw a 22% rise, while the Cadillac Escalade's sales climbed by 16%.

Understanding the Allure: Why Middle Eastern Consumers Embrace American SUVs

Numerous factors underpin the significant demand for GM's large SUVs in the Middle East. These vehicles provide a compelling blend of power, spaciousness, and advanced technology, which perfectly aligns with the preferences of regional customers. A notable demographic emerging as a key audience for models like the Tahoe and Escalade consists of young adults aged 20 to 29. Furthermore, there has been a noticeable increase in ownership among Asian expatriates and female buyers. GM's nearly century-long presence in the Middle East has fostered deep brand loyalty, evidenced by a 33% increase in repeat after-sales customers over the last five years. The robust economy of the region, coupled with a cultural inclination towards large, capable vehicles, creates an ideal environment that complements the premium market positioning of these SUVs in both the Middle East and the United States.

Beyond SUVs: American Automotive Brands Discover New Opportunities Abroad

GM's success is not limited to its SUV offerings. In August 2025, the Chevrolet Corvette achieved its highest monthly sales in the Middle East since 2015. The mid-engine C8 Corvette has redefined global perceptions of American performance cars, transforming the Corvette from a traditional muscle car into a legitimate contender in the supercar category. As traditional markets present new challenges, American manufacturers are discovering the Middle East to be a fertile ground for expansion. Ford, for instance, doubled its regional sales between 2022 and 2024, becoming Saudi Arabia's fastest-growing automotive brand. The region's preference for powerful automobiles, combined with evolving demographics and economic prosperity, creates unforeseen and highly favorable opportunities.
